Strictly supports 2nd Generation Intel Core i3, i5, i7 (Sandy Bridge), Pentium, and Celeron processors. It generally does not support 3rd Generation (Ivy Bridge) CPUs. Despite its advanced features and robust design, the
Standard 1.5V DDR3 modules are native. Low-voltage 1.35V DDR3L modules are usually backward compatible but will run at 1.5V. Front Panel Header Pinouts

The internal audio header follows standard Intel HD Audio pinouts. However, the board lacks an internal 20-pin USB 3.0 header. If your new PC case has front-panel USB 3.0 ports, you will need a PCI-E expansion card with an internal 20-pin header to make them functional.
